The landscape in the Oberallgäu is as varied as its sights. From caves and small grottos to varied vantage points and rushing gorges, the region offers a wide range of natural attractions. The "Nagelfluhkette" Nature Park in particular attracts numerous nature lovers and sports enthusiasts every year with its flora, fauna and its striking peaks.

The Starzlachklamm is a gorge located near the Sonthofen district of Winkel. It was formed over several thousand years by the mountain stream of the same name.

The lake Großer Alpsee is situated in the region Allgäu, northwest of the town Immenstadt. It is the biggest natural lake in the area and a popular place for bathing, swimming, sailing and surfing.
